actually I find the best photos i get of me are the ones I take myself ROFL

The one on my blog for example {that one was done useing a tripod though}

I'm a bit nutty about takeing photos of me - if you leave a camera in my hands for long enough there will surely be some point where I turn the camera around and take a photo of myself - my tips for this kind of camera takeing is that you hold the camera Up as if it was looking down at you - look into the lens and push your chin out just a little {well if you're like me and want to avoid the double chin shot haha}

ohh and dont' be concentraing to hard that you forget to smile {I'm always doing that one hehe}
